It all really depends on what you would like? Some monitors are "ADHD" while others are bi-polar. Some are arboreal while others are terrestrial; hell some are both. Then you have your highly aquatic monitors. They also have different needs and enclosure requirements. You mentioned mid-sized, well that's a step in narrowing the selection. You must consider feeding and how much it will cost to keep him/her healthy. Also consider your electric bill and what space you are willing to give up in your house. Can daily cleaning and maintenance be incorporated into your lifestyle? Whatever you read, bring it up here and see what you are told. There is not one way to keep monitors, but there are parameters that most follow. These are just some things to consider, but hey I'm still just a newbie myself. Good Luck.
